Looking for a Marketing Consultant Professional - III for Basking Ridge, NJ.
What you will be doing as a Marketing Consultant Professional - III:
Aligned with CX Strategy, the Contractor in Performance Management will assist in planning and driving the actual performance tracking for all NPS programs.
By combining customer metrics with operational and business data, you will evaluate actual KPI results of critical customer experience improvement initiatives.
You will also deep dive into NPS performance metrics and calculate the ROI and perform root cause analyses.
The contractor will also help set NPS performance metrics targets.
The role will include balance strategic thinking, policy and process transformation, project management, results accountability, cross-functional collaboration, creative ideas and "rolling up the sleeves" to resolve tactical issues.
You are able to challenge the status quo by demonstrating a willingness to re-invent the current experience journeys and adopt change as a challenge.
Identifying and resolving performance barriers post launch highlighting system, process and labor issues driving continuous improvement cycles.
Evaluating and reporting impact of Marketing and Channel initiatives on Digital KPI performance in partnerships with those teams.
What you will bring to the table as a Marketing Consultant Professional - III:
Bachelor's degree or two or more years of relevant work experience.
Four years or more of relevant work experience.
Knowledge in marketing, business transformation, customer experience either in a business, agency or consulting organization.
Strong Performance Management experience by developing, implementing and tracking results, KPI deep dives, goal tracking, segment performance, trend deep dives and identifying result drivers.
Experience with developing and automating data analytics and visualizations tools such as SQL, Tableau, Thoughtspot etc.
